Transaction 4668096fdef89aa4c64e1d7abbce97348c2c53a16d28418902c0435b3b025deb

1 Input
2 Outputs
  • 4668096fdef89aa4c64e1d7abbce97348c2c53a16d28418902c0435b3b025deb:0
  • value  1457000
    address  3CF472SZhFAEADZZcEvGw6qF7eoert8NXG
  • 4668096fdef89aa4c64e1d7abbce97348c2c53a16d28418902c0435b3b025deb:1
  • value  142489428
    address  358YKTAKWi79KGnxibDK7BJKu7d3sVRNMp